## Deployment

The Coldhaven archiver runs as a scheduled job that sweeps inactive storage buckets into glacier-tier archives. For the sync: deployment is fully declarative — push the manifest, and the scheduler picks up changes within ten minutes. Buckets marked with a retention hold are always skipped. Note that the sweep window was widened last release to reduce contention with nightly backups. The job reads the following configuration at startup.

deployment values, hahaf-fahop:
zorwyn:
  log_level: debug
  metrics_host: metrics.zorwyn.tolvaqlabs.internal
  pool_size: 8

# Runbook: Hunting leaked file descriptors in Quillgate

When the `fd_open` gauge climbs steadily between deploys, suspect a leak rather than load. First confirm on a single pod: exec in and count entries under `/proc/1/fd`, noting how many are sockets in CLOSE_WAIT versus regular files. Capture two snapshots ten minutes apart before restarting anything — we need the delta for the postmortem. Reproduce locally with the Marbury load harness, which requires the service running with the following configuration values.

settings of yagep-bajog:
[istdor]
port = 4000
region = south-2
host = istdor.qorvelcorp.internal
timeout_ms = 5000
retries = 5

Looks like the fill heuristic regression we patched last sprint snuck back in during the solver refactor — the symmetry validator passes, but the word-length constraint runs before pruning instead of after. About 14% of nightly puzzles are affected, so nothing's shipped to readers yet. When you review the fix branch, sanity-check the constraint ordering and drop any concerns to the puzzles maintainer.

escalation mailbox, yajeg-bageg: quenax.olidor@lumiccorp.internal

Hey, handing this off before I'm out. The retry path in Ledgerfox now requires idempotency keys on every payment attempt — keys are generated client-side, hashed server-side, and expire after 48 hours. Worth a security pass on the key derivation and replay window. All the design notes and threat model live on the page below.

wiki page, fahaf-yagag: https://confluence.qorvellabs.internal/pages/display/pages/display